A personal injury lawsuit typically takes 1-3 years to resolve, depending on complexity and settlement negotiations.
Estimated Duration: 730 days
The duration of a personal injury lawsuit varies based on factors like case complexity, evidence gathering, negotiations, and court schedules. Initial consultations with lawyers take days, investigations may last months, pre-trial procedures (discovery, depositions) can take 6-12 months, and trials add further time. Most cases settle out of court within 1-2 years, but contested cases may extend to 3+ years.
